Longtime @ToledoWalleye forward Conlan Keenan is officially retiring. Keenan played in the fourth most games in Walleye history (297). He ranks 8th in team history in goals scored (65) and 12th in total points (134), and 7th in shots on goal (538). Class act, true pro, warrior.

For the first time since 2018, the Toledo Walleye will not advance to the conference finals after they were eliminated from the Kelly Cup playoffs by the rival Fort Wayne Komets on Tuesday night. toledoblade.com/sports/walleye…
